Time difference between Australia and Nigeria

7 hours to 9 hours, depending on the city

Why there is no single answer

Australia spans 2 different offsets in this data — Brisbane, Sydney and Melbourne at UTC+10, Perth at UTC+8. One number cannot cover 2 offsets, so any single figure for "Australia to Nigeria" is a choice of city — declared or not. That is why two sources can both be right and still disagree, and why the useful answer is the table rather than the number.

When the gap moves

2 of these 4 combinations change by an hour at some point in the year. Brisbane, Perth and Lagos do not change their clocks; Sydney and Melbourne go forward on the first Sunday in October and back on the first Sunday in April. Where the two sides change on different weekends, there is a stretch of days when the difference is what neither party expects.

About these places

Brisbane. Brisbane is UTC+10 and does not change its clocks, while Sydney and Melbourne — the same offset in winter — go an hour ahead in October. For half the year Queensland is an hour behind its southern neighbours, which is a standing annoyance for anyone scheduling across the east coast.

Sydney. Sydney is UTC+10 in winter and UTC+11 from October to April. Its summer is the northern hemisphere's winter, so the gap to Europe and North America swings by two hours over the year rather than staying put.

Melbourne. Melbourne keeps the same clock as Sydney, UTC+10 in winter and UTC+11 in summer, and changes on the same dates. The pair are the reason "Australian Eastern Time" needs the Standard or Daylight qualifier to mean anything between October and April.

Perth. Perth is UTC+8, the same as Singapore and Beijing, and is the only Australian capital that does not change its clocks. Western Australia has rejected daylight saving in four referendums, most recently in 2009.

Lagos. Nigeria is UTC+1 with no daylight saving. It matches Central European Time in winter and falls an hour behind in summer, so a standing Lagos–Berlin meeting moves twice a year entirely at the European end.
